Hydraulic pumps operated manually
Hands Pumps
Characteristics of hydraulic fluids
Can operate in extreme pressure (4000 psi)
Can operate in extreme temperatures
Must remain viscous
Must have a high flash point
Two types of hydraulic fluids
Mineral and Synthetic Based
What holds all the hydraulic fluid not contained in lines and components?
Reservoir
What controls the direction of fluid flow into an actuator or motor?
Selector Valves
Name 2 devices that are used to transmit power through hydraulic fluid.
Actuator and Motor
Actuators provide what kind of motion?
Linear
Motors provide what kind of motion?
Rotational
What stores fluid under pressure to absorb pressure surges and acts as a temporary, single-use, emergency pressure source?
Accumulator
What displays system pressure in psi?
Pressure gauges
